Manas
Manas National Park, located in Assam, is a UNESCO World Heritage Site and a Project Tiger reserve, known for its diverse wildlife and scenic beauty. It borders Bhutan's Royal Manas National Park, forming a transboundary conservation area.
attractions Top Attractions
Manas National Park Core Area
The core area of Manas is where the densest wildlife populations reside. It offers the best chances to spot tigers, elephants, rhinos, and other mammals.
Mathanguri
Mathanguri is a picturesque spot on the banks of the Manas River. It offers stunning views of the river and the surrounding landscape.
Bansbari Tea Gardens
The Bansbari Tea Gardens offer a glimpse into Assam's tea-growing heritage. The lush green tea bushes create a beautiful landscape.

Guwahati
Guwahati, the largest city in Assam, serves as the gateway to Northeast India. Situated on the banks of the Brahmaputra River, it's a bustling urban center with a blend of ancient temples, modern infrastructure, and natural beauty.
attractions Top Attractions
Kamakhya Temple
Kamakhya Temple, dedicated to the goddess Kamakhya, is one of the most revered Hindu temples in India. It is located on Nilachal Hill and is an important pilgrimage site for Tantric worshippers.
Umananda Island
Umananda Island, also known as Peacock Island, is the smallest inhabited river island in the world. It is located in the middle of the Brahmaputra River and is home to the Umananda Temple dedicated to Lord Shiva.
Assam State Museum
The Assam State Museum showcases the rich history and culture of Assam. It houses a collection of sculptures, artifacts, and ethnographic exhibits.

Where to Eat in Hojai: Local Cuisine Guide
Must-Try Dishes in Hojai
Don't leave Hojai without tasting these local specialties:
- Assamese Thali - A complete meal with rice, dal, vegetables, fish/meat curry, and local side dishes. Available at most local dhabas, rupees 150-250.
- Khar - An alkaline dish, often made with raw papaya or fish, unique to Assamese cuisine. Try at Hotel Royal Palace, rupees 100-180.
- Masor Tenga - Tangy fish curry, a staple in Assamese households. Look for it at local eateries near the market, rupees 120-200.
- Pitha - Traditional Assamese rice cakes, sweet or savory, often eaten during festivals. Found at street stalls in Hojai Market, rupees 20-50 per piece.
- Duck Curry - A rich and flavorful curry, often prepared for special occasions. Available at larger restaurants like Hotel Royal Palace, rupees 250-400.
- Aloo Pitika - Mashed potato dish, simple yet flavorful, often served as a side. Common in all local dhabas, rupees 50-80.
